Schedule Immediate Gas Line Repair When You See These Signs

A gas leak can put you and your family in a dangerous situation. Never second-guess yourself when it comes to recognizing the warning signs. If you notice any of the following red flags, schedule an immediate professional gas line repair service.

Hissing

Gas can escape whenever there’s a crack or hole in the gas line. These may be too small to see, but you’ll hear the hissing sound the escaping fuel creates. Immediately shut off your gas valve as soon as you hear this, and call a professional for help.

Corrosion

Corrosion and rust are the result of moisture coming into contact with the pipes that make up your gas line. It may be tempting to ignore any rust you find, but the extent of the corrosion can quickly escalate. It’s best to get a professional opinion as to whether or not the gas line needs immediate repair or not.

Odd Odors

Mercaptan is added to natural gas to give it the odor of rotten eggs. Otherwise, you wouldn’t be able to smell it. If you notice that strange odor in your home, you’ll know you have a gas leak. Call for immediate expert repair as soon as you recognize this distinct scent.

High Utility Bills

A problem with your gas line can cause your monthly utility bill to suddenly spike. This is because a gas line in need of repair causes you to use more fuel than you normally would. Don’t put off calling a professional. Having the gas line repaired will save you money in the long run.

Health Issues

Exposure to a gas leak deprives your body of sufficient oxygen. This results in concerning health issues, as natural gas is toxic. If you have a leak in your gas line, you may experience dizziness, headaches, and fatigue. You may also have trouble breathing and experience flu-like symptoms.
